Kompletní popis

Heidegger provides a lively and accessible introduction to one of the most influential and intellectually demanding philosophers of the modern era. Covering the entire range of Heidegger's thought, but focusing on his key work, Being and Time, Richard Polt skillfully guides readers through the texts using clear examples and vivid language.
